Williams-Sonoma, Inc. (Symbol: WSM) is a universally recognized, industry-leading, American retail company that specializes in kitchenware and home furnishings. Operating as a multi-channel retailer, WSM encompasses various well-acclaimed brands such as Pottery Barn, West Elm, and of course, its namesake Williams-Sonoma, appealing to a comprehensive range of consumer tastes. Established in 1956, the company over the decades has leveraged its retail presence with robust e-commerce operations, solidifying its status as a staple in the retail sector. From modest cookware shops to a global, multi-brand, multi-channel enterprise, WSM is the embodiment of corporate resilience, growth, and adaptability. With its commitment to customer service, innovation, and quality, Williams-Sonoma currently dominates its market niche, playing an instrumental role in shaping the home goods retail landscape.

Williams-Sonoma Inc. (WSM) has been on a roll, with its stock price rising 41% year-to-date. The company's strategic partnerships and expansion initiatives, like the collaboration with renowned chef Marcus Samuelsson for its West Elm brand, have been paying off. While the broader market faces macroeconomic headwinds, WSM seems to be navigating these challenges well through its operational efficiency. The company's diverse product portfolio and focus on home furnishings, which have been in high demand, make it an attractive investment option. I believe WSM's strong brand recognition, innovative approach, and ability to adapt to changing consumer preferences position it for continued growth in the second half of the year.
